Nautilus is a Doug Peterson design built for New York Yacht Club members as an offshore one-design class. Her sleek lines and dark blue hull with flush deck are very handsome. Nautilus has seen many recent notable improvements that keep her looking great. Some of these important improvements are:
- Awgripped Hull with Aristo Blue & a Gold Imron Stripe (2012)
- Replaced Lifelines (2012)
- Replaced Engine Mounts & Cutlass Bearing (2013)
- New Transmission (2013)
- Serviced Seacocks (2013)
- Replaced One Seacock (2013)
- Varnished Trim (2013)
- Winches Serviced (2013)
- Replaced Steeling Idler Plate (2013)
- Replaced all Manual Bilge Pump Hoses (2013)
- Replaced Two Deck Hatches (2013)
- Replaced One Deck Hatch lens (2013)
- New Baltoplate Bottom (2013)
Nearly $95,000 has been spent on Nautilus in just the past two years leaving her turning heads in any harbor! She is stored indoors every winter and fully serviced by Conanicut Marine Services.
